Understanding AFib

When AFib becomes a problem

Atrial fibrillation is the most common heart rhythm disorder. It causes the upper chambers of the heart to beat irregularly, leading to symptoms like palpitations, fatigue, dizziness, and shortness of breath.

For many patients, medication alone is not enough. When symptoms persist or worsen, catheter ablation becomes a recommended treatment option — a minimally invasive procedure that targets the source of the irregular rhythm.

Delays in access to treatment can lead to disease progression and reduced quality of life. Our program is designed to reduce those delays through a structured, coordinated pathway.
